React pathname
WebOct 27, 2024 · The component is the most important component in React Router. It renders some UI if the current location matches the route’s path. Ideally, a component should have a prop named... WebJul 20, 2024 · In your tests, pass the history object as a whole to the Router component. Note: React Router v5 only works with History v4 , so make sure you have the correct version of history installed. // app.test.js. import {render, screen} from '@testing-library/react'.
React pathname
Did you know?
WebDefinition and Usage The pathname property sets or returns the pathname of a URL (page). Syntax Return the pathname property: location.pathname Set the pathname property: location.pathname = path Property Values Return Value Browser Support location.pathname is supported in all browsers: Previous Location Object Reference Next Report Error WebApr 21, 2024 · useLocation ().pathname in react-router-dom is changing, but when I put it in an if statement, it keeps saying true. I'm making a react app. I'm importing useLocation …
WebInstead of using window.location, React Router has the concept of a location that's patterned after window.location but is much simpler. It looks like this: { pathname: " /bbq/pig-pickins", search: " ?campaign=instagram", hash: " #menu", state: null, key: " aefz24ie" } The first three: { pathname, search, hash } are exactly like window.location. WebJul 4, 2024 · action (string): (POP, PUSH, REPLACE) POP: Visiting the route via url, Using history go function ( history.goBack (), history.goForward (), history.go ()) PUSH: Using history.push () REPLACE: using history.replace () .push (pathname: string, state: any)/ (location: object): push a path or location to the history stack.
WebFeb 2, 2024 · Hey - I want a sort function that is determined by the url, the routes are set up in the parent App.js (and correspond to the heading of a column in a table). At the moment location is coming up undefined. sortCities = () => { switch (this.props.location.pathname) { case "cities/city": return this.props.cities.sort((a, b) => { return a.city.localeCompare(b.city); … Web前沿:跳转分两种情况,然后这两种情况又有不同参数 一。html的方式跳转(Link标签) 第一种 pathname + query 这种形式的传参式隐式的(url看得到参数,类似get请求数据) 【跳转新页面】不会丢失query参数(即target='_blank')- dva/router 第二种 pathname + state 这种形式的传参式隐式的(url看不到参数,类似 ...
WebApr 11, 2015 · The last path that went through your run callback, which is usually the last path that you rendered with React.render(). This can differ from browser history, e.g. after using browser back button it would refer to the next page in browser history. ... Now you can use window.previousLocation.pathname to get the pathname anywhere in ...
WebuseRouter is a React Hook, meaning it cannot be used with classes. You can either use withRouter or wrap your class in a function component. router object. The following is the … how blood flows through the bodyWebGet the current route in React Router using dynamic routes Get the current URL and Pathname in React # Use the window object to get the current URL in React, e.g. … how blood flows throughout the bodyWebJan 24, 2024 · React Router が提供する location オブジェクトを返すフック。 location オブジェクトは以下の情報を持っています。 - pathname:URL - search:クエリパラメータ - hash:URL ハッシュ - state:ユーザ定義のデータ これらの情報は Link コンポーネントや、history オブジェクトで履歴操作時に渡すことができます。 その情報を遷移先のコンポー … how many padma vibhushan awardees in 2022WebJan 28, 2024 · url.pathname property accesses the pathname of the URL: const url = new URL('http://example.com/path/index.html?param=value'); console.log(url.pathname); Try the demo. If the URL doesn't have a path, the url.pathname property returns a slash character /: const url = new URL('http://example.com/'); console.log(url.pathname); Try the demo. 6. … how blood clots dissolveWebFeb 18, 2024 · import { useLocation } from "react-router-dom"; const Contact = () => { const { pathname } = useLocation (); return ( Contact Current URL: {pathname} ) }; Final Thoughts React Router is an amazing library that helps us go from a single page to a multi-page application feeling with great usability. how blood clots are treatedWebJul 28, 2024 · とりあえず window.location.pathname を記述しても取得は可能; だが、きっとスマートな方法があるに違いないと思っている; 2024年時点でのReact初学者; 調べると、どうやらReactは歴史があり、時期によって推奨される記述方法やモジュールが変遷しているように感じ ... how blood flows through your bodyWebJan 4, 2024 · pathname: Current route. That is the path of the page in ‘/pages’. query: The query string parsed to an object. asPath: The path (including the query) shown in the browser. But useRouter () is a react hook so if you use this inside a class component and this will give an error. how blood groups are inherited class 10